Heavier 88, 90 or 95gr .224 will deliver even more energy down range with the 22 Creedmoor, but you will need at least a 1-7 or 1-6.5 twist to stabilize them properly as we found our 1:8 twist Krieger 28.1 barrel was just not enough to stabilize the 88gr Hornady ELD-Match bullets (even though Hornady recommends 1-7 minimum we still had to try), and the sweet spot was the 75gr Hornady ELD-Match for our 1:8 twist rate. Savage pre fits come in 2 shank sizes; Standard (small) Shank / 1.058"-20, Large / 1.120"-20. A barrel log should be kept for each rifle in your Shooting Record Book, or Field Data Book, and may also be stored on an electronic copy or cloud drive for safekeeping.
